Output e596dc22d5eb96a2dd76cf7b060cb3c6c9eb6b2e9be607c0ec37fbacf50e3bef:54

value
63718
script pubkey
OP_0 OP_PUSHBYTES_20 f95c04a5cb0a2904b8adb9d2f05fc348042eb2ec
address
bc1ql9wqffwtpg5sfw9dh8f0qh7rfqzzavhvsy9qhs
transaction
e596dc22d5eb96a2dd76cf7b060cb3c6c9eb6b2e9be607c0ec37fbacf50e3bef
confirmations
117950
spent
true